Checkle
Search
For Businesses
Yamazato Japanese Restaurant
Menu
Yamazato Japanese Restaurant Menu
$
·
Japanese
21039 Timberlake Rd, Lynchburg, VA 24501
Order Online
http://lynchburgyamazato.com
http://lynchburgyamazato.com
Menu
Menu 2
Yamazato Bubble Teas
Menu Gallery
Menu Gallery
Menus may not be up to date.
Suggest Edit
Know a great happy hour or special for this location?
Add Happy Hour